UPDATE: City of Red Bank Passes 16-Cent Property Tax Increase

The plan includes employee raises, capital spending and financing for equipment and vehicles, while one commissioner opposed the tax increase.

Summary by Local 3 News
Red Bank residents may face a 14% property tax increase to fund key community projects including facilities maintenance, a new loan, the former middle school site, and park improvements, with a proposed tax rate rising from $1.13 to $1.29. The budget proposal hearings begin May 19 for council review.
